Explain the procedure of plant tissue culture and illustrate your answer with a suitable diagram.

Plant tissue culture is a technique used to grow new plants from a small piece of plant tissue under sterile conditions in a nutrient medium. The process involves: 1. Selection of an explant (a small tissue from a plant). 2. Sterilization to prevent microbial contamination. 3. Placement in a nutrient-rich culture medium containing growth hormones. … Read more
